Type
ORACLE
Validation date
2024-10-17 20:44: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01431,
    "usd": 0.01549
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000115831357AF73EE6428E5F694DABA899D2B6222C13451E85FF54FE6032D9C0319

Previous signature

246A6A9486FF6D8932C5A77330805DC469633191674BE2931873E78EA55E190EA32EBA04C984BBE43E2CA7DD5965C1F43D0219D84E6ABB184284F0AEDC107109

Origin signature

304402200209CB73C2F796BEFB62F2EEF9103B61FAED862330C65A7619C5291348190F1E02204BF06B3FA8D9D156503E2F4EC465CE392B48A4886553C38E3AAB953B737E8BC2

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

009E925A50920F81175176F47760ED8B058396A58798899166D720ED4C81D29070

Coordinator signature

2818812543535626665D1728BF33BFE1377F739E11F9B58481037E20A446E75F7D18C44E2E8FA874295752F9EFDE0BC46EA6BA32E070AF1AED2D335EC17C3809

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

072AEB5B971246E06CC548E2327E3093B3807DF196FC45071E4EEB2DDCBFA112674B48DE51F269F41C079D0C472977A8BC9A99CC0715FDFE9F01CF27F2FE510B

Validator #2 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#2 signature

D973FFC596F754FEB0A504A71B81580A04AD161A694E0E1FD55181B18D72EBD49F6CC89961D6F5AF23ADCCB5136594995DDE717C26A20C634B3C2A098FB23D09